Brief Summary

The purpose of this study is to determine whether transjugular intrahepatic portosystemic shunt (TIPS) with 10-mm covered stent is associated with lower shunt dysfunction in comparing TIPS with 8-mm covered stent in cirrhotic patients with at least one episode of variceal bleeding.

Eligibility Criteria

Age18 Years - 75 Years
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sAdult (18-64), Older Adult (65+)

You may qualify if:

  • Cirrhotic patients with at least one episode of variceal bleeding
  • No active bleeding within 5 days before TIPS
  • Child-Pugh score ≤13
  • Signed written informed consent

You may not qualify if:

  • An age \<18 years or \>75 years
  • With TIPS contraindications
  • Past or present history of hepatic encephalopathy
  • Pregnancy or breast-feeding
  • Hepatic carcinoma and/or other malignancy diseases
  • Sepsis
  • Spontaneous bacterial peritonitis
  • Uncontrollable hypertension
  • Serious cardiac or pulmonary dysfunction
  • Renal failure
  • Portal vein thrombosis
  • History of organ transplantation
  • History of HIV (human immunodeficiency viruses) infection
